    Community Health Worker (CHW), Patient Advocacy Team - Volunteer Opportunity:

    Organization: HHP

    Location: Remote/Flexible

    Time Commitment: ~3 hours per week

    Role Overview

    Help advance HHP’s mission to improve health literacy and empower underserved communities by serving as a vital link between health and social services and the community. You will help patients facilitate access to care and improve health outcomes.

    This is an entirely volunteer, remote-only position with flexible hours, giving preference to U.S.-based candidates.

    Role Balance: This role is 100% Direct Service/Patient Advocacy Focus.

    Duties (Reporting to the Patient Advocate Lead)

    • Serve as a liaison between health and social services and the community to facilitate access and improve health outcomes.
    • Activities include outreach, community education, informal counseling, social support, and patient advocacy.
    • Increase health knowledge and self-sufficiency through culturally appropriate education on topics like chronic disease prevention and nutrition.
